Foot Locker
139 Lincoln Mall Dr 60443-2330 Matteson Illinois USA
- Profile: Foot Locker is a Shoe stores company located at Matteson, Illinois USA, address is 139 Lincoln Mall Dr, Matteson 60443-2330 IL, postcode is 60443-2330, you can contact Foot Locker by phone 9097705347